How difficult is it to become a motor coach driver?

Becoming a motor coach driver typically requires a commercial driver's license (CDL) with passenger endorsement, which involves passing written and skills tests. Candidates often need a clean driving record, a background check, and may need to complete specialized training or certification programs. Experience driving large vehicles is also beneficial for this role.

What is the difference between Motor Coach Driver vs Bus Driver?

AspectMotor Coach DriverBus Driver
CredentialsCommercial Driver's License (CDL), passenger endorsementCDL or standard driver's license, passenger endorsement
Work EnvironmentLong-distance travel, tours, charter servicesPublic transit, school routes, local transportation
Employer & IndustryTour companies, charter services, travel industryPublic transit agencies, schools, private companies
Common Search/ComparisonMotor Coach Driver vs Bus Driver

Motor Coach Drivers and Bus Drivers both operate large passenger vehicles and require similar licensing. However, Motor Coach Drivers typically handle long-distance, charter, or tour routes, while Bus Drivers usually serve local transit or school routes. Their work environments and employer types differ, but both roles focus on passenger safety and customer service.

How to become a motor coach driver?

To become a motor coach driver, you typically need a valid commercial driver's license (CDL) with passenger and air brake endorsements, along with a clean driving record. Most employers require completion of a training program or on-the-job training to learn safety procedures and vehicle operation. Additionally, drivers must pass background checks and medical examinations to ensure fitness for the job.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a motor coach driver?

To thrive as a Motor Coach Driver, you need a valid commercial driver's license (CDL) with a passenger endorsement, a strong driving record, and knowledge of vehicle safety regulations. Familiarity with GPS navigation systems, electronic logging devices (ELDs), and basic vehicle maintenance tools is typically required. Excellent customer service, patience, and strong communication skills help drivers manage passenger needs and ensure a positive travel experience. These skills and qualifications are crucial for ensuring passenger safety, regulatory compliance, and high-quality service on the road.

What are some of the main challenges motor coach drivers face during long-distance routes?

Motor Coach Drivers on long-distance routes often encounter challenges such as maintaining alertness over extended hours, managing varying traffic and weather conditions, and ensuring passenger comfort and safety throughout the journey. Additionally, they must adhere to strict schedules while complying with federal regulations on driving hours and rest breaks. Effective communication with dispatchers, tour guides, and passengers is also essential to handle unexpected delays or route changes smoothly.

What is a motor coach driver?

Motor Coach Drivers are professional drivers responsible for operating large passenger buses, often referred to as motor coaches, for the transportation of groups of people. They may drive for tour companies, charter services, or scheduled intercity bus lines. Their duties include ensuring passenger safety, assisting with luggage, following predetermined routes, and maintaining schedules. Motor Coach Drivers must also perform routine vehicle inspections and provide excellent customer service throughout the trip.
